(PWR) reported first-quarter 2026 earnings per share of $2.68, significantly exceeding the consensus estimate of $2.082 by 28.72%. Revenue details were not disclosed for the period. The stock responded positively, rising approximately 0.91% in after-hours trading as investors cheered the earnings surprise.

Management cited strong operational execution and favorable tailwinds in the energy infrastructure and grid modernization markets as key drivers of the earnings beat. The company continues to benefit from increased demand for electric utility and renewable energy construction services, supported by long-term secular trends such as electrification and decarbonization. During the quarter, Quanta’s project backlog remained healthy, and the company maintained disciplined cost controls, which contributed to better-than-expected profitability. Segment performance was not fully detailed, but overall margin trends appear to have improved compared to earlier guidance. Management also noted that labor availability and supply chain dynamics remain manageable, allowing the firm to execute on a robust pipeline of large-scale projects. The quarterly result reinforces Quanta’s position as a leading specialty contractor in the energy sector, with a growing emphasis on high-voltage transmission and renewables. Looking ahead, Quanta’s management expressed cautious optimism, noting that demand for infrastructure services may continue to accelerate as federal and state spending programs take effect. The company expects to benefit from ongoing investments in grid hardening, renewable energy generation, and data center construction, though project timing could introduce variability. Guidance for the full year was not revised in the announcement, but management indicated that the strong start to 2026 could provide upside to annual targets if market conditions remain supportive. Key risk factors include potential cost inflation for raw materials and skilled labor shortages in certain regions. The company also highlighted that permitting delays and regulatory changes could affect near-term project starts. Despite these challenges, Quanta’s strategic priority remains expanding its service offerings in high-growth verticals while maintaining a disciplined capital allocation approach. The market reacted favorably to the earnings surprise, with the stock gaining 0.91% in the after-market session, signaling that investors viewed the EPS beat as a positive signal amid a period of heightened macroeconomic uncertainty. Several analysts may revise their estimates upward following the report, given the magnitude of the surprise relative to consensus. The lack of disclosed revenue data raised some questions, but the strong bottom-line performance appeared to overshadow those concerns. Near-term focus will be on the company’s next quarterly report to gauge whether the earnings momentum is sustainable and to obtain a clearer picture of top-line trends. Additionally, investors will watch for updates on the company’s backlog conversion rate and any potential M&A activity that could further bolster its competitive position. The market’s tempered reaction also reflects a broader cautious stance toward industrial names exposed to cyclical spending patterns.
